Output ad84f672175bc592bf9f8d476d27ad7b0803b9dd38db150ae73aa9c548ed2a22:29

value
750635556
script pubkey
OP_0 OP_PUSHBYTES_20 e1d991b5a509831507488fe1e11f2bcfdf963de2
address
bc1qu8verdd9pxp32p6g3ls7z8etel0ev00z48gmxl
transaction
ad84f672175bc592bf9f8d476d27ad7b0803b9dd38db150ae73aa9c548ed2a22
spent
true